Operational Flows

From supplier to dashboard without losing the thread.

Quantifeye ERP organizes commercial, kitchen, e-commerce, cashier, returns, accounting, fiscal, and service processes into traceable flows.

Commercial flow with physical inventory

Supplier → purchase order → warehouse receiving → branch or seller assignment → sale / pre-invoice → inventory discount → dashboard.

Restaurant / kitchen flow

WhatsApp order → ERP receives sale → kitchen order → preparation → product ready → dispatch → sales report.

E-commerce / QR flow

Web purchase → digital or cash payment → ERP validates order → QR generation → mobile app → access / gate → fiscal control.

Cash and reconciliation flow

Cash opening → sales and payments → returns / adjustments → cash count → close → reconciliation → report.

Returns flow

Request → SKU / IMEI validation → return to warehouse → re-entry or discard → inventory adjustment → reconciliation → report.

Accounting / fiscal flow

Sale or purchase → fiscal document → PAC validation → accounting entry → posted status → audit → executive dashboard.

Marine services flow

Service request → vessel → inspection → spare parts → work order → closure → receivables and dashboard.
